As babymog said; if your Fuel has become contamineted by something growing in it or just bad fuel from the Pump a Filter can clog again quickly.
You often see in Posts something like; I just change my filter last week and now I have the same problem. What is wrong?
To see if it an issue with the Fuel Tank Screen you can swap positions of the Fuel Return Hose and the Fuel Inlet Hose. However, if you do they the Fuel will be drawn from a higher position inside of the Fuel Tank and you need to keep the Tank above 1/2 full so you do not run out of Fuel. Just do it to test.
To see if it is a restricted Fuel Tank Vent try driving without the Fuel Fill Cap on; but, do not do that on a full Tank of Fuel. Don't want Fuel blowing out on the paint job.
If you still have the Old Filter you could cut it apart and take a look at what is inside.
